WebMay 27, 2024 · These women are entitled to 60% of the basic state pension their husband gets at SPA. For 2024-21 the full basic state pension is £134.25 per week, and the rate for married women claiming on this basis would be £80.45 per week. Under this old system each member of a couple could build up a pension in their own right. WebNov 12, 2024 · Tens of thousands of married, divorced and widowed women are to be paid back more than £100m in underpaid state pensions by the Department for Work and Pensions (DWP). It follows new evidence given to MPs by DWP permanent secretary Peter Schofield, based on findings from pensions consultancy Lane, Clark & Peacock (LCP) in …
